The introduction of DataDirect Connect for ADO.NET Entity Framework
provider for Oracle provides software developers and architects with fully
featured design to boost success with the Entity Framework. Like its
predecessors before, version 3.3 of the Progress DataDirect Connect for
ADO.NET product has raised the bar for superior performance, security and
interoperability. Using 100 percent managed-code architecture, DataDirect
Connect for ADO.NET eliminates the need for Oracle database client
libraries -- both instant and client. Because managed code runs in the
Common Language Runtime (CLR) environment, it reduces risks such as memory
leaks and closes security holes that unmanaged code leaves exposed,
providing developers secure, reliable and versatile deployment options
available in both application and client-server environments. This allows
software developers and architects to avoid the versioning headaches
associated with the ODP.NET provider and the multiple versions of the
Oracle client libraries and databases used throughout the enterprise.

Offering support for LINQ to Entities, EntitySQL and ADO.NET Data Services,
the Progress DataDirect data provider exposes Oracle data sources to the
complete functionality of the ADO.NET Entity Framework using any
application development technology. With its deep rooted, technical
relationships with all major database and platform vendors, Progress
DataDirect ensures its data connectivity products support the latest
provider features and database versions.
